8 ENG 1 GOTH I C GA Z E T T EAn Aurora College Student Publication

As part of our study on the convention of Gothic literature,students were tasked with the challenge of using some ofthe conventions we had studied in class to develop a fifty-word story that spooked an audience.

What you read in the following pages is the result. And awarning... some of these tales are sure to raise goosebumpsor make your heart race faster!

I was sorting through old trinkets when I heardthe noise. Crash! I had dropped one of mygrandfather's old glass balls, with a name on thefront for some reason. As soon as it shattered, Iheard a scream from a few doors down: Theneighbour's husband had died.

LOTUS TURNER

The door creaked ever so slightly as he edged it open.He crept into the room ever so slowly, with incrediblecare. This was the night, the night that he would befreed of the monster. With practiced ease he raisedhis arm and brought it down, stabbing.

DOM MONTGOMERY

"Daymo," the shadowy whisper of my name chillsdown my spine. "Daymo" the voice repeats. A shudder takescontrol of my body momentarily for a second.That's when it happens. I freeze, as the voicewraps its shadowy whisper around me, trappingme in its spell.

OTTO RICHTER

The room was dark, awfully dark. The longsmooth boards of the floor simply morphed intothe chipped plasterboard that clad the walls andthen ran into the crown moulding of the roof.Shapes were dancing around the walls, like balletperformers on a grand stage, dipping and divingin the candle flame's flickering light. Crash! Andeverything went deathly silent, and so did I.

CHARLIE HOUGH

Blood slowly dripped down the knife, ripped fromthe flesh it had been thrust into. Slowly shecleaned the blood off with her tongue; hermother had always told her to keep things niceand clean. She had tried for so long to do as shesaid. She didn't need to anymore.

BLAKE DREW

He let out a soft sigh, careful to not make toomuch noise. He bent down next to therectangular hole that had once been filled in withtightly compacted dirt to keep in the monster.But now, the dirt was scattered around the graveloosely. The monster had escaped.

AMY LITTLETON

My eyes darted to the figure travelling,whispering in the night. My body clings to itself.My blood pumps. I look on and search for theclosest weapon to get me out of this mess. I see itthe bloody red knife but I'm too slow, I screambut no one can hear me. I struggle for a breathheaving and puffing. The knife that I sought, mysaviour, stabs my spleen. My saviour, my demise.

JACKSON LANE

A shadow crept into the chamber. It moved everso slowly towards the old woman. It took a sharpblade that glinted in the moonlight and stroked itover her windpipe. Her screams were silencedwith a pillow and blood dripped onto thefloorboards, staining them for eternity.

LOLA STRAVOSKOUFIS

Stone walls each side of him. His head whippedaround in terror searching for a way out. Butinstead of escape, he saw the body. Beaten andbruised, it gasped, blood spluttering from itsmouth. And just like that it was dead. Now he wastrapped here, surrounded by death.

ALICE WEST
